Second, the method of conversion

1. Open the "Database Source" in the Administrative Tools under the Control Panel;

2. Press "Add" to add a new data source, select "Driver do Microsoft Access (* .mdb" in the selection bar, one box will appear after completion,

In the "Database Source", enter the name you want to write, I am named "abc", indicating that you don't need to fill, then follow the choices, look for your database address and selection (note, please first

Back up your own Access database) and then determine.

The data source is built here, and the remaining is converted.

3. Open SQL2000 Enterprise Manager, enter the database, create a new empty database "ABC";

4. Select the newly established database, right-click, select "Import Data" under "All Tasks", press "Next" to continue;

5. In the database source, DRIVER DO Microsoft Access (*. MDB) ", in" User / System DSN ", select" ABC "you just added, press" Next ";

6. "Destination" does not need to be modified, select the server (generally "local", you can also select the server address or

LAN address, determine if your permissions can be operated, "Use Windows Authentication" means that "Using SQL Identity Operation Verification" can be used for the operation of the website, recommended the latter;

7. After selecting "Use SQL Identity Operation Valid", fill in your username and password, I choose the system default number "sa", "****", database selection "ABC", press " Next step ";

8, this step two single options, "from the data source replication table and view" and "data to be transmitted by a query command", select the former, press "Next" to continue;

9, here will appear in your own Access database, follow the "All Choice", next step;

10, "DTS Import / Export Wizard", see "Running" is selected as "next step",

11. Continue by "Complete";

12, this step you will see that your data is imported into SQL2000, when "has successfully imported XXX a table imported into the database", and all the table has a green hook, it means successfully imported all data, If there is a problem in the middle or a red fork in front of the table, it means that the table does not have successfully imported, then go back to see if your own operation is correct.

Third, data modification

1. Since there is no "automatic number" inside SQL2000, you will become a non-empty field with the fields set "Auto Number", which must be manually modified and the "marked" "Yes", The seed is "1", the increment is "1",

2, in addition, the Access 2000 is converted to SQL2000, the original attribute "Yes / No" will be converted into non-empty "bit", and you must modify the properties you want;

3, in addition, everyone should pay attention to the grasp of the time function. There are many differences between Access and SQL.
